What Is Tear Trough Filler?

Tear trough filler involves injecting hyaluronic acid into the hollow groove beneath the lower eyelid to correct volume loss and reduce the appearance of dark circles. The treatment is performed with a fine needle or cannula for precise, natural-looking results.

Who Is This Treatment For?

Good Candidates

  • Adults with visible tear trough hollows
  • Those with dark circles caused by volume loss
  • Patients seeking a non-surgical refresh
  • People with early periorbital aging
  • Those who want reversible under-eye correction

Exercise Caution

  • Severe under-eye puffiness or fat herniation
  • Active skin infection near the eye area
  • History of severe filler reactions
  • Pregnancy or breastfeeding
  • Very thin or fragile under-eye skin

Treatment Approaches

Classic HA Filler

Standard Volume

Hyaluronic acid filler placed precisely along the tear trough for immediate volume correction.

  • Immediate visible result
  • Reversible treatment
  • Natural soft finish

Cannula Technique

Reduced Bruising

A blunt-tip cannula minimizes trauma to delicate under-eye vessels, reducing bruising risk.

  • Less downtime
  • Lower bruising risk
  • Smooth distribution

Combination Approach

Enhanced Results

Tear trough filler combined with cheek support filler for a lifted, harmonious correction.

  • Addresses root cause
  • Longer-lasting lift
  • Full mid-face refresh

Is tear trough filler painful?
Topical numbing cream is applied before treatment to minimize discomfort. Most patients feel only mild pressure during injection.
How long does tear trough filler last?
Results typically last 9 to 12 months depending on the filler used and individual metabolism. A touch-up session can extend longevity.
Is there downtime after the procedure?
Minor swelling or bruising may occur for 2 to 5 days. Most patients return to daily activities the same day.

Can tear trough filler be dissolved?
Yes, hyaluronic acid filler can be dissolved with hyaluronidase if needed. This provides an added safety margin for patients.
